MINI LIVING-BUILT BY ALL
MINI and Studiomama
Salone del Mobile 2018, Milan
MINI LIVING and the London firm Studiomama show how to turn abandoned spaces into potential livable ones.

The installation BUILT BY ALL concentrated four inhabitable cells in less than 20 square meters, designing them under the MINI principle, a creative use of space where footprint is minimized and flexibility maximized. The project arose in response to the limitations on access to housing adapted to current needs of society, including people’s desire to make dwellings their own through active participation in the design process and subsequent changes. In Shanghai now, on a larger scale, there is a project for a complex of over 50 apartments and communal facilities organized around the same revolutionary concept of habitation.
